#7b3e0d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#7b3e0d is composed of 48.2% red, 24.3% green and 5.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 49.6% magenta, 89.4% yellow and 51.8% black. It has a hue angle of 26.7 degrees, a saturation of 80.9% and a lightness of 26.7%. #7b3e0d color hex could be obtained by blending #f67c1a with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#663300.

Shades and Tints of #7b3e0d
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#110802 is the darkest color, while #fffefe is the lightest one.
